Recommendations

Tactics

Pick a stretch of steady current, chum one spot and fish it — don't move around without reason.

Lures

Today's bait — maggot or small hook with dough bait. In cold or murky water, add scent to your chum.

Gear

No special gear needed — seasonal clothing will do. Rain is expected — don't forget a rain jacket or a waterproof shell.
